Google’s Structured Data Testing Tool can help review and validate structured data implementation against their rich result features requirements. The different Google ‘rich result’ search features require different types of structured data and implementing them can help achieve rich snippets (a more stand-out, detailed ‘snippet’ in the search results) which may result in more traffic. Structured data provides search engines with explicit clues about the meaning of pages and their components and can enable special search result features and enhancements in Google.
